    LG 43UF7709 - Blinking Screen, No Picture, No Sound

    Hi everbody,

    my LG TV 43UF7709 wont turn on. It only tries to show something, but it stays only blinking. So i removed the Backcover and first checked some Voltages.

    I get on the powersupply all Voltages correctly, equal to the schematics nearby. The only thing i get maybe wrong is "LED+". On the Powersupply there stand it had to be 50V Output. I only get 38V on LED+. Could this be a failure?

    Also there is a LED, LD701 which blinks 6 times in row YELLOW. What can this mean?

    I also checked Powersupply out of the chassis. I couldn´t find any issues. But have to say, that i´m not a pro.

    I also checked Voltage on TCON Fuse: I get 11,5V on each side.

    What i noticed to is that the heatsink on the mainboard run very hot.

    Would be have, if we can get this TV back to life

                Re: LG 43UF7709 - Blinking Screen, No Picture, No Sound

                Maybe try jump starting the powerboard WITHOUT mainboard connected, I think you use a 1k resistor from power on pin to 3.5 standby and another resistor from 3.5 standby pin to drv-on pin, then see if your proper voltages are there and if backlights come on. MAKE sure cable from powerboard to mainboard is unplugged for this test.

                Comment


                  #9
                  Re: LG 43UF7709 - Blinking Screen, No Picture, No Sound

                  Yes sir, connected Power on to 3.5 and drv on to 3.5 ans get backlights shining.

                  On power on and drv on i only get 3.29V. Should be okay i think?
                  But what does lightning backlight mean? Does the Mainboard have issues?

                  Comment


                    #10
                    Re: LG 43UF7709 - Blinking Screen, No Picture, No Sound

                    Usually that proves the backlights and powerboard are ok, looks like the mainboard is not sending the drv-on signal.
